    Hintergrund

    Synonyms: 133 kDa FK506-binding protein, 133 kDa FKBP, C430014M02Rik, FK506 binding protein 135, FK506-binding protein 15, FKB15_HUMAN, FKBO133, FKBP-133, FKBP-15, FKBP133, Fkbp15, KIAA0674, mKIAA0674, Peptidyl prolyl cis trans isomerase, RIKEN cDNA C430014M02 gene, RP23 64F17.7, WAFL, WASP and FKBP-like.

    Background: May be involved in the cytoskeletal organization of neuronal growth cones. Seems to be inactive as a PPIase (By similarity). Involved in the transport of early endosomes at the level of transition between microfilament-based and microtubule-based movement.
